= уже type string); кто кто",name,cost,payout); dini_Set(String, не POS[1], [выплата] его = } всем strval(tmp); [Название]"); = [id]]"); на вопросов r; } if(!strlen(tmp)) = SendClientMessage(playerid, нет Z); if(strcmp(cmd, SendClientMessage(playerid,Red,"Это } максимальное 0xFF0000AA, RadarInfo[radarid][rSpeed] что = Здравствуйте! бизнеса","Вы busid,cost,payout,name[128]; создано if(RadarInfo[r][rPlayer] Поблизости new успешно = { создателям "BusX", return cmd, POS[2]; = создал true)) Create3DTextLabel(Label,White,X,Y,Z,100.0,GetPlayerVirtualWorld(playerid),1); владельцем И RadarInfo[r][rPlayer] { idx); tmp radarid /addbus Продаётся\nСтоимость: { $%i", OwnBus[playerid] else return SendClientMessage(playerid, создано Выплата: name; Z); Уже Данный if(!radarid) SendClientMessage(playerid,Red, return Не "Payout",payout); POS[0], 20) рестарта IsPlayerInRangeOfPoint(playerid, POS[1]-0.5, >= RadarInfo[radarid][rObject] dini_FloatSet(String, 1; Y, [выплата] true) 0.0, if(PlayerRadars[playerid] r; new true) idx); tmp = РАДАРЫ 0x27C400FF, return сохраняются RadarInfo[radarid][rSpeed] cost == = GetPlayerName(id,Name,MAX_PLAYER_NAME); %s\nВдаделец: то "Использование: создать "пригородный"; "HasOwner",0); dini_IntSet(String, владелец { else 2: } идет new [id]"); тип 0x27C400FF, strval(tmp); не dini_Create(String); = BusinessInfo[busid][CP1] всем, new return ">>> уже switch(strval(tmp)) } PlayerRadars[playerid]++; if(!strcmp("/setradar", кучи return CreateObject(18880, playerid; Y); if(!strlen(tmp)) /addbus = продать могу являетесь radarid "| уже "/addbus", || } [выплата] радаров."); if(PlayerInfo[playerid][pMember] } //Бизнесы SendClientMessage(playerid,Red,"Вы SendClientMessage(playerid, /addbus format(String, как } RadarInfo[r][rPos][0], //if(sscanf(cmdtext,"iiis",busid,cost,payout,name))return $%i\nВыплата: sizeof(String), SendClientMessage(playerid, 3: 1; = format(Label, проекта! SendClientMessage(playerid, if(!IsPlayerAdmin(playerid))return и strtok(cmdtext, максимальное = /delbus [Название]"); String[200]; idx); break; "Использование: создан = SendClientMessage(playerid, { спасибо name); POS[3]); = RadarInfo[radarid][rPlayer] /* { (а [Бизнес false; [Стоимость] RadarInfo[radarid][rActive] Float:X,Float:Y,Float:Z; "| for(new == бизнеса"); "Название: ">>> cost; радаров."); ID] return { } ID] помогает 0) за Не SendClientMessage(playerid, INVALID_PLAYER_ID; радара if(!IsPlayerAdmin(playerid))return type idx); "OwnedBus",0); SERVER:Unknown 1: ]"); данном dini_FloatSet(String, r++) if(!strlen(tmp)) case проблема ID] очень задал /setradar = RadarInfo[r][rPos][2])) new busid { кто 1) Вами."); BusinessInfo[busid][bName] до "BusZ", 0x27C400FF, command true) карте SendClientMessage(playerid, 0; } = [Бизнес [выплата] if(OwnBus[playerid] default: X); количество $%i strtok(cmdtext, POS[0]-0.5, [Бизнес возможно свой POS[1], = 0.0, /delbus format(String,sizeof(String),"Название: бизнес?","Продать","Нет"); /addbus 1; %s PlayerInfo[playerid][pLeader] = затруднит, бизнес.",Name); Понимаю, new -1; | return пригородный"); 20 вопрос 0xDEDEDEFF, return ID] 0xDEDEDEFF, return "World",GetPlayerVirtualWorld(playerid)); GetPlayerPos(playerid, strtok(cmdtext, что [Стоимость] { 0; idx); MAX_PLAYER_RADARS) 1; POS[0]; strval(tmp); помог "шоссейный"; { [Стоимость] } "Name", != 3: = type[64]; name,cost,payout); //Радар [Бизнес r<MAX_RADARS; {DEDEDE}%s", BusinessInfo[busid][bLabel] case strtok(cmdtext, | dini_FloatSet(String, на if(!strcmp("/delradar", бизнесом) радар if(!RadarInfo[r][rActive]) 90, сервере = SendClientMessage(playerid, "Использование: return 1; Использование id; Радар "Cost",cost); БИЗНЕС 0) удалили "Использование: Стоимость: GetPlayerFacingAngle(playerid, tmp { break; тип 1: что делаю /addbus tmp CreateDynamicCP(X,Y,Z,1.0,GetPlayerVirtualWorld(playerid),GetPlayerInterior(playerid),-1,50.0); payout; за new SendClientMessage(playerid, радаров."); dini_Set(String, $%i [Название]"); форуме, strtok(cmdtext, = 128, 0) шоссейный"); 2: GetPlayerPos(playerid, "Использование: new if(PlayerInfo[playerid][pMember] name cmd, true)) (( payout BusinessInfo[busid][Payout] 0; tmp радара"); BusinessInfo[busid][Cost] PlayerInfo[playerid][pLeader] "Owner","No >>> == [выплата] SetPlayerPos(playerid, new RadarInfo[radarid][rSpeed] ">>> выдает: String); 20 20) [Название]"); еще = type 60, ">>> { { искреннее bool:radarid; { POS[1]; if(radarid = = || конечно 0x27C400FF, ID] Спасибо if(RadarInfo[r][rActive] case занят."); new -1, String[200]; type); { POS[2]-2.5, POS[2]); new количество SendClientMessage(playerid, 3.0, if(!strlen(tmp)) Ты "/sellbus", if(!strlen(tmp)) Owner"); "BusY", MAX_RADARS) Владелец: (( "Вы DestroyObject(RadarInfo[r][rObject]); свой for(new "/delbus", прочитал 1; RadarInfo[radarid][rPos][1] SendClientMessage(playerid, RadarInfo[r][rPos][1], ShowPlayerDialog(playerid,220,DIALOG_STYLE_MSGBOX,"Продажа } = "| new == 0xDEDEDEFF, на [Стоимость] = return if(strcmp(cmd, установлен return SendClientMessage(playerid, PlayerRadars[playerid]--; COLOR_GRAD2, SendClientMessage(playerid, %s если сервера. COLOR_GRAD2, = 0x27C400FF, format(String,sizeof(String),"Business/%i.ini",busid); } [Стоимость] r++) RadarInfo[r][rActive] Float
OS[4]; dini_IntSet(String, if(!strlen(tmp)) POS[3]); бизнес COLOR_GRAD2, "Использование: "Использование: = COLOR_GRAD2, SendClientMessage(playerid, | playerid) //if(sscanf(params,"u", if(dini_Exists(String))return = return (код не Очередная = { } dini_IntSet(String, return true; городской"); не POS[0], } X, [Название]"); много правильно) SendClientMessage(playerid, радара: был true; SendClientMessage(playerid,Green,String); POS[2]); 120, && r<MAX_RADARS; == strval(tmp);*/ r; и COLOR_GRAD2, ">>> RadarInfo[radarid][rPos][0] ">>> new radarid dini_IntSet(String, RadarInfo[radarid][rPos][2] id))return тип же. Неверный == сразу "Interior",GetPlayerInterior(playerid)); dini_IntSet(String, sizeof(Label), | 0xFF0000AA, [Бизнес dini_IntSet(String, "городской"; не == ">>> format(string, хотите после == SendClientMessage(playerid, то [ = } if(strcmp(cmd, >= 0x27C400FF,